Maranacook Community School Trails, Readfield

QUICK TRAIL FACTS

  • Preserve Size: 320 acres
  • Trail Mileage: ~ 3.6 miles in network
  • Pets: yes
  • Difficulty: easy
  • Sights: forest, fields, stream

Readfield Fairground trails in blue; Maranacook Community School trails in red

This trail system, which is great for hiking, running, and cross-country skiing, connects to the beautiful trail around the Readfield fairgrounds. The hiking paths also link up to snowmobile trails, which I didn’t include on my map. I found a pretty good map of the system, which includes the way the trails have been blazed — which I found a little confusing when I was out there without a map.

Directions: After going up the school complex on Millard Harrison Drive, you can pick up the trail at several points around the school grounds. I walked into the wooded trail system from behind the baseball field closest to the school. Or you can connect to it from the Readfield Fairgrounds, where it might be easier to park when the school is in session.
